My Buying Guides on Black Bathroom Trash Can

Why I Prefer a Black Bathroom Trash Can

When I choose a bathroom trash can, I often go with black because it looks clean, modern, and easy to match with most bathroom styles. In my experience, black also does a better job of hiding small stains, scuffs, and everyday wear compared to lighter colors. That makes it a practical choice for a room that gets used often.

Size and Capacity I Look For

For my bathroom, I usually pick a trash can that is compact but still large enough to handle daily waste without needing constant emptying. A small to medium size works best for me, especially in a guest bathroom or a space with limited floor room. If I’m buying for a family bathroom, I consider a slightly larger capacity so it stays functional throughout the day.

Material That Works Best for Me

I pay close attention to the material because it affects both durability and appearance. Metal trash cans feel sturdy and often look more premium, while plastic ones are lightweight and easy to move. In my experience, a matte finish is great for reducing fingerprints, while a smooth finish can be easier to wipe clean. I choose the one that best fits my cleaning routine and bathroom style.

Lid Style I Prefer

For bathrooms, I usually like a trash can with a lid because it helps contain odors and keeps the space looking neat. A step-on lid is convenient when my hands are full, while a swing lid or touch-top lid can be simpler for quick use. If I’m placing it in a small bathroom, I make sure the lid opens easily without taking up too much extra space.

Ease of Cleaning Matters to Me

I always think about how easy the trash can will be to clean. Bathrooms can get humid, so I prefer a model that wipes down quickly and doesn’t trap moisture or grime. Removable inner buckets or smooth surfaces make maintenance much easier for me. The easier it is to clean, the more likely I am to keep it looking good over time.

Design and Style I Consider

Since the bathroom is a visible part of the home, I like choosing a trash can that complements the room’s overall design. A sleek black trash can can blend well with modern, minimalist, or classic bathroom decor. I usually look for simple shapes and clean lines because they make the space feel more organized and polished.

Stability and Non-Slip Features

I’ve found that a bathroom trash can should stay in place, especially on tile or smooth floors. A stable base or non-slip bottom helps prevent it from sliding around when I use it. This is especially important in a small bathroom where every item needs to stay neatly positioned.

Odor Control I Pay Attention To

In my experience, odor control is one of the most important features in a bathroom trash can. A lid helps a lot, but I also like cans that work well with small liners and easy-empty designs. If I know the trash will include tissues, cotton pads, or other bathroom waste, I make sure the can helps keep smells contained.
